#396b47 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#396b47 is composed of 22.4% red, 42%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.6%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 136.8 degrees, a saturation of 30.5% and a lightness of 32.2%. #396b47 color hex could be obtained by blending #72d68e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#396b47

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020503 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#396b47

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c584f is the less saturated color, while #00a42e is the most saturated one.
